With permits and financing secured, the construction and installation phase of a solar project can commence. This phase is where the physical solar panels and equipment are installed on-site and connected to the power grid. It includes several key steps that require careful planning and execution.

It is during the Option Period, that the solar project development process occurs. This process, which can take around 3-4 years, involves significant investment from the developer. It is, therefore, important to maintain a solid partnership between the landowner and the developer.

Project Construction and O&M. Once a project is contracted, construction begins on roads, fences, the solar array, and other subsystems. The project is then connected to the electric grid. Once constructed, the solar power facility will have full-time staff to manage long-term operations and maintenance (O&M).

What is a Solar EPC? | Essentials of Engineering, Procurement, and ...
In the world of solar energy, the term "Solar EPC" frequently comes up. But what does it really mean? EPC stands for Engineering, Procurement, and Construction. An EPC contractor in solar projects is responsible for handling the entire project from start to finish. This comprehensive role is crucial for the successful implementation of ...
